NeoGenomics Inc. reported Q1 2026 earnings per share of $0.01, exceeding the consensus estimate of $0.0072 by 38.89%. Revenue details were not disclosed in the provided data. The stock rose 6.48% following the announcement, reflecting investor optimism around the better-than-anticipated earnings.

NeoGenomics delivered a positive earnings surprise for the first quarter of 2026. Adjusted EPS of $0.01 marks a return to profitability compared to prior periods, driven by disciplined cost management and improving operational leverage. The company’s core clinical testing segment likely benefited from higher test volumes and favorable pricing, though specific revenue figures were not provided. Sequential margin improvement may have been supported by ongoing restructuring initiatives and efficiency gains in the lab network. NeoGenomics has been focused on scaling its oncology testing menu, including liquid biopsy and molecular profiling services. The earnings beat suggests that management’s efforts to streamline expenses—such as reducing headcount and optimizing facility utilization—are beginning to yield tangible results. However, without revenue data, it is difficult to ascertain whether top-line growth contributed to the EPS outperformance.

NeoGenomics did not issue formal guidance in the available data, but the company expects continued progress toward sustainable profitability. Management may reaffirm its focus on high-margin test offerings and strategic partnerships with pharmaceutical firms for clinical trial support. Risks remain, including potential reimbursement headwinds, competitive pressures from larger diagnostics firms, and variability in test volumes. The company anticipates that further operational efficiencies could support margin expansion in the coming quarters. Additionally, NeoGenomics may prioritize investments in technology and data analytics to enhance customer experience and drive long-term growth. Given the uncertain macroeconomic environment and healthcare spending trends, the company’s ability to sustain earnings momentum will depend on disciplined cost control and successful commercial execution.

The stock’s 6.48% gain post-earnings indicates that investors focused on the positive EPS surprise rather than the lack of revenue disclosure. Analysts may view the beat as a sign that NeoGenomics’ turnaround strategy is gaining traction, although some might caution that revenue stagnation could limit further upside. The market might watch for upcoming quarters to confirm whether this profitability improvement is durable. Key factors to monitor include test volume growth, gross margin trends, and any updates to the company’s guidance. If NeoGenomics can demonstrate consistent earnings power, the stock could attract value-oriented healthcare investors. Conversely, if revenue remains flat or declines, the share price may face resistance. Overall, the quarter provided a positive data point, but a fuller picture of financial health awaits revenue and cash flow disclosures.
